1 |
commit: 8000a18e51631d5ef563000469ab6d0a3d60e24e |
2 |
Author: Sam James <sam <AT> gentoo <DOT> org> |
3 |
AuthorDate: Tue Dec 29 08:35:03 2020 +0000 |
4 |
Commit: Sam James <sam <AT> gentoo <DOT> org> |
5 |
CommitDate: Tue Dec 29 08:35:03 2020 +0000 |
6 |
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=8000a18e |
7 |
|
8 |
media-libs/openjpeg: fix install locations patch |
9 |
|
10 |
Closes: https://bugs.gentoo.org/762373 |
11 |
Package-Manager: Portage-3.0.9, Repoman-3.0.2 |
12 |
Signed-off-by: Sam James <sam <AT> gentoo.org> |
13 |
|
14 |
.../files/openjpeg-2.4.0-gnuinstalldirs.patch | 25 +++++++++++++++++----- |
15 |
1 file changed, 20 insertions(+), 5 deletions(-) |
16 |
|
17 |
diff --git a/media-libs/openjpeg/files/openjpeg-2.4.0-gnuinstalldirs.patch b/media-libs/openjpeg/files/openjpeg-2.4.0-gnuinstalldirs.patch |
18 |
index 7b0014980fd..82ad4075a94 100644 |
19 |
--- a/media-libs/openjpeg/files/openjpeg-2.4.0-gnuinstalldirs.patch |
20 |
+++ b/media-libs/openjpeg/files/openjpeg-2.4.0-gnuinstalldirs.patch |
21 |
@@ -4,7 +4,7 @@ Date: Thu, 11 Apr 2019 13:10:57 +0200 |
22 |
Subject: [PATCH] Use GNUInstallDirs for standard installation directories |
23 |
|
24 |
Raises minimum cmake version by a little. |
25 |
-- Later rebased by sam@g.o for 2.4.0 |
26 |
+(Later rebased by sam@g.o for 2.4.0) |
27 |
--- a/CMakeLists.txt |
28 |
+++ b/CMakeLists.txt |
29 |
@@ -7,7 +7,7 @@ |
30 |
@@ -81,7 +81,22 @@ Raises minimum cmake version by a little. |
31 |
option(OPJ_USE_DSYMUTIL "Call dsymutil on binaries after build." OFF) |
32 |
endif() |
33 |
|
34 |
-@@ -366,14 +335,14 @@ if(BUILD_PKGCONFIG_FILES) |
35 |
+@@ -342,14 +311,6 @@ install( FILES ${OPENJPEG_BINARY_DIR}/OpenJPEGConfig.cmake |
36 |
+ ) |
37 |
+ |
38 |
+ #----------------------------------------------------------------------------- |
39 |
+-# install CHANGES and LICENSE |
40 |
+-if(BUILD_DOC) |
41 |
+-if(EXISTS ${OPENJPEG_SOURCE_DIR}/CHANGES) |
42 |
+- install(FILES CHANGES DESTINATION ${OPENJPEG_INSTALL_DOC_DIR}) |
43 |
+-endif() |
44 |
+- |
45 |
+-install(FILES LICENSE DESTINATION ${OPENJPEG_INSTALL_DOC_DIR}) |
46 |
+-endif() |
47 |
+ |
48 |
+ include (cmake/OpenJPEGCPack.cmake) |
49 |
+ |
50 |
+@@ -366,14 +327,14 @@ if(BUILD_PKGCONFIG_FILES) |
51 |
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/src/lib/openjp2/libopenjp2.pc.cmake.in |
52 |
${CMAKE_CURRENT_BINARY_DIR}/libopenjp2.pc @ONLY) |
53 |
install( FILES ${CMAKE_CURRENT_BINARY_DIR}/libopenjp2.pc DESTINATION |
54 |
@@ -98,7 +113,7 @@ Raises minimum cmake version by a little. |
55 |
endif() |
56 |
# |
57 |
if(BUILD_JPIP) |
58 |
-@@ -381,7 +350,7 @@ if(BUILD_PKGCONFIG_FILES) |
59 |
+@@ -381,7 +342,7 @@ if(BUILD_PKGCONFIG_FILES) |
60 |
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/src/lib/openjpip/libopenjpip.pc.cmake.in |
61 |
${CMAKE_CURRENT_BINARY_DIR}/libopenjpip.pc @ONLY) |
62 |
install( FILES ${CMAKE_CURRENT_BINARY_DIR}/libopenjpip.pc DESTINATION |
63 |
@@ -107,7 +122,7 @@ Raises minimum cmake version by a little. |
64 |
endif() |
65 |
# |
66 |
if(BUILD_JP3D) |
67 |
-@@ -389,7 +358,7 @@ if(BUILD_PKGCONFIG_FILES) |
68 |
+@@ -389,7 +350,7 @@ if(BUILD_PKGCONFIG_FILES) |
69 |
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/src/lib/openjp3d/libopenjp3d.pc.cmake.in |
70 |
${CMAKE_CURRENT_BINARY_DIR}/libopenjp3d.pc @ONLY) |
71 |
install( FILES ${CMAKE_CURRENT_BINARY_DIR}/libopenjp3d.pc DESTINATION |
72 |
@@ -318,7 +333,7 @@ Raises minimum cmake version by a little. |
73 |
+mandir=${prefix}/@CMAKE_INSTALL_MANDIR@ |
74 |
+docdir=${prefix}/@CMAKE_INSTALL_DOCDIR@ |
75 |
+libdir=${prefix}/@CMAKE_INSTALL_LIBDIR@ |
76 |
-+includedir=${prefix}/@CMAKE_INSTALL_INCLUDEDIR@/@OPENJPEG_INSTALL_SUBDIR@ |
77 |
++includedir=${prefix}/@CMAKE_INSTALL_INCLUDEDIR@/@OPENJPEG_INSTALL_SUBDIR@ |
78 |
|
79 |
Name: openjp3d |
80 |
Description: JPEG2000 Extensions for three-dimensional data (Part 10) |